On November 7, 2019, Adult Swim announced that the show has been renewed for a second season, which had a stealth premiere on April 1, 2020 and officially premiered on December 7, 2020.
In June 2021, writer Judnick Mayard announced that Adult Swim cancelled the series after two seasons.
Synopsis
''Lazor Wulf'' follows a wolf who carries a laser on his back and the adventures he and his pack of carefree friends face while hanging out at their neighborhood joints like The Clurb and Esther's.
